Some tips for anyone who tries the game:
Pay attention to the heat bar. When it gets high enough, you start losing health. The heat-releasing special attacks are pretty awesome, but they have a cooldown. If you hold down the fire button all the time, you will cause yourself unavoidable heat damage.
Remember your guided missiles (right-click, IIRC), and aim them with the mouse. They're incredibly useful.
